Hooks是一项新功能,允许开发人员在不编写类的情况下使用状态和其他React功能。
在 useCallback 钩子中使用 Axios 时,React 函数组件无限重新渲染?
这是一个文件上传组件,一切都按预期工作,但是,当尝试在 useCallback 中使用 Axios POST 文件时,ProgressBar 组件会无限地重新渲染,如果有...
如何正确修复 React Hook useCallback 缺少依赖项
我在 React typescript 项目中使用 airbnb 更新了我的 Eslint 规则。 我现在收到这些错误: React Hook useCallback 缺少依赖项:“setCookie”。任何一个 包含它或删除依赖项...
使用 useMemo/useCallback 时需要考虑计算成本较高的时间限制
根据包括 React 文档在内的数十篇文章,使用 useCallback 和 useMemo 挂钩有助于防止不必要的重新渲染。 另一方面,这些性能优化挂钩不是免费的,并且
我正在关注 React tictactoe 教程 https://react.dev/learn/tutorial-tic-tac-toe。我添加了一个清晰的按钮/功能,但它没有做任何事情。有谁知道为什么? 从 're... 导入 React
我正在开发一个 React 的 Hangman 网站,该网站允许用户创建单词和命中供其他用户解决,现在我正在开发一个组件,该组件允许用户看到一些提示,也许......
无法在 React 中读取 null 的属性(读取“map”)
我试图让我的搜索栏显示一些结果,但它没有,并且显示错误 无法读取 null 的属性(读取“map”) // 从“axios”导入 axios; 导入反应,{
使用React,我正在尝试制作一个国际象棋网站。 在我的 App 函数中,我有以下代码: const [playerSide, setPlayerSide] = useState('White'); 函数 switchPlayerSide() { 控制台....
我正在尝试使用 useImperativeHandle 但仍然收到错误“无法添加当前属性,对象不可扩展”。每个教程中的代码都以类似的方式编写,并且正在工作......
如何使用 useFormStatus 钩子处理 Next JS 表单中多个提交按钮的加载状态
我在 Next JS 14.2.2(应用程序路由器)应用程序中有一个简单的 html 表单。该表单有两个提交按钮,即 Button1 和 Button2。我正在使用react-dom中的useFormStatus钩子来处理负载...
NextJS:即使使用 useEffect,仍然触发“窗口未定义”错误
我正在尝试在我的 NextJS 应用程序中集成 JS 库,但是加载页面时我总是在服务器端收到以下错误: ReferenceError:窗口未定义 我不明白为什么...
我在反应时收到错误“无法读取 null 的属性(读取“地图”)”,请参阅我的代码
我正在用 React 构建一个电影网站,问题发生在 usestate 我想请看一下 我试图让我的搜索栏显示一些结果,但它没有,并且显示错误......
我正在建立一个这样的状态: const 今天 = new Date(); const 年 = 今天.getFullYear(); const 月份 = String(today.getMonth() + 1).padStart(2, '0'); const day = String(today.getDate()).padS...
React 在该 Div 中添加一个类,而不是在其他 Div 中
我是 React 新手,面临一个问题。 我有几个 div,当单击一个 div 时,我只想在这个 div 中添加一个新类。 问题是当我单击一个类时,它会在该 div 中添加一个新类...
React useParams 根本不显示参数,返回具有多个值的对象
我正在研究 React 并路由 App.js 中的一些链接,其中 2 个有一个 :id 参数,如下所示 从“反应”导入反应; 导入“./App.css”; 导入 { BrowserRouter as ...
React useState Hook:在 useEffect 之前状态不更新
我在组件中遇到了 React useState 钩子和 useEffect 钩子的问题。当我使用 setData 更新状态时,在 useEffect 挂钩 c 之前状态似乎没有更新...
React 18.2.0 在 onClick 时动态生成表单 - 表单来表示深度嵌套的 JSON
我有一个深度嵌套的 JSON 对象。我想显示与 JSON 值相关的输入字段。为了遍历深度嵌套的 JSON 对象,我使用了递归并收集了所有 pro...
我在尝试根据 React 组件中的查询参数过滤产品时遇到问题。我有一个主要组件,可以从上下文中获取产品并提取查询参数...
React TypeScript 16.8 如何使 useEffect() 异步
为什么useEffect()不能使用async-await? const Home: React.FC = () => { useEffect(异步() => { console.log(等待 ecc.randomKey()) }, []) 返回 ( ... 错误...
我正在使用下面的包react-if。 https://www.npmjs.com/package/react-if 但我的子组件没有渲染。我正在尝试这样 ReactDOM.createRoot(document.getElementById('root')!).rende...
useEffect 在 chrome.storage.local 中的数据更改时更新状态
我的代码运行得很好,但是当我更新本地存储中的某些内容时,除非重新加载应用程序,否则我的应用程序不会更新。我想做的是自动更新数据...